使用: System.exit()方法
System.exit():System.exit(int status) 方法可用于退出 Java 虚拟机。通常将非零值作为参数传递给该方法,表示程序异常终止。调用 System.exit(0) 表示正常退出程序。
System.exit(0);
其中的System.exit(0);
其是一种在执行时终止 Java 虚拟机 (JVM) 的方法,这也会导致当前正在运行的程序终止。它需要一个参数,即状态。如果状态为 0,则表示终止成功,而非零状态表示终止不成功。
使用:return关键字
在主方法或其他任何方法中使用 return 语句可以退出当前方法,并返回到调用方。如果在主方法中使用 return 语句,将会结束整个程序的执行。
return;
可以运用在程序退出上也可以运用在函数值返回上。
使用异常
抛出一个未被捕获的异常也可以导致程序退出。
public class ExceptionExample { public static void main(String[] args) { System.out.println("Before exception"); throw new RuntimeException("Exception occurred"); // 抛出异常,退出程序 System.out.println("没有执行!!!"); // 不会执行到这里 }}
来源地址:https://blog.csdn.net/weixin_45686922/article/details/131584943